Legal Requirements for Land Surveyor Stamps in Wyoming

In Wyoming, the use of a land surveyor stamp is governed by specific legal requirements. The Wyoming State Board of Registration for Professional Engineers and Professional Land Surveyors, which oversees the licensing and regulation of land surveyors, sets forth these requirements.

To use a land surveyor stamp in Wyoming, a land surveyor must be licensed by the state board. The stamp must include the land surveyor's name, license number, and the words "Professional Land Surveyor" or "P.L.S." Additionally, the stamp should contain the phrase "State of Wyoming" and the year of expiration of the surveyor's license.

Wyoming land surveyor stamps are typically required on survey plats, subdivision plats, boundary surveys, topographic surveys, and other surveying documents that are submitted for approval or recordation. Traditional Rubber Stamps

Traditional rubber stamps are a classic and cost-effective option for land surveyors. These stamps consist of a rubber die mounted on a wooden or plastic handle. To use a traditional rubber stamp, you will need a separate ink pad. When pressed onto the ink pad and then onto paper, the rubber die leaves a clear and crisp impression.

One of the benefits of traditional rubber stamps is their versatility. They allow for the use of different ink colors and are easily customizable. However, it's worth noting that traditional rubber stamps require manual ink application and may require re-inking more frequently compared to other stamp types.

Self-Inking Stamps

Self-inking stamps are a convenient and efficient option for busy land surveyors. These stamps incorporate an ink pad within the stamp mechanism, eliminating the need for a separate ink pad. With each impression, the stamp automatically re-inks itself, making it ready for the next use.

The primary advantage of self-inking stamps is their ease of use. They offer quick and consistent impressions with minimal effort. The built-in ink pad also ensures that the stamp is always properly inked, reducing the chances of smudging or smearing. Self-inking stamps are available in various sizes and can be customized with your desired text and design.

Pre-Inked Stamps

Pre-inked stamps are another popular option for land surveyors. These stamps contain ink within the stamp die itself, eliminating the need for an external ink pad. The ink is released through microscopic pores in the die, resulting in clean and precise impressions.

The main advantage of pre-inked stamps is their ability to produce high-quality, detailed impressions. The ink distribution system ensures even ink coverage, resulting in sharp and legible imprints. Pre-inked stamps also require less frequent re-inking compared to traditional rubber stamps. However, it's important to note that pre-inked stamps may have a slightly longer drying time, so it's advisable to allow a few seconds for the ink to fully dry.
